Location: Leeds initially, with travel to sites across the North East and other areas as required

Working Hours: Monday-Friday, 8:00am-4:00pm

Start Date: Immediate

We are currently recruiting on behalf of an established construction client based in Richmond, North Yorkshire, who are looking for an experienced Site Manager to join their team on an immediate-start basis. The successful candidate will initially be working on a small project in Leeds, with the opportunity to support the client across further projects throughout the North East and other areas following completion.

This is a hands-on site management position suited to someone with solid construction experience who can confidently take responsibility for the day-to-day running of a site.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Manage the day-to-day activities on site.
  • Coordinate subcontractors, trades and site personnel.
  • Ensure works are delivered safely, efficiently and to the required standard.
  • Monitor progress and ensure works remain on programme.
  • Maintain high standards of health and safety.
  • Manage site logistics, deliveries and materials.
  • Liaise with project management and other key stakeholders.
  • Identify and resolve issues on site.
  • Maintain relevant site documentation and records.
  • Ensure the project is delivered to the required quality and timescales.

Requirements:

  • SMSTS - essential.
  • Proven experience as a Site Manager within the construction industry.
  • Strong knowledge of site health and safety requirements.
  • Excellent organisational and communication skills.
  • Confident managing subcontractors and site teams.
  • Ability to work independently and take ownership of site delivery.
  • Full UK driving licence.
  • Willingness to travel to other sites across the North East and wider areas.
